Palsoni
Palsoni is a village located in Wani tehsil of Yavatmal district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Wani (tehsildar office) and 102km away from district headquarter Yavatmal. As per 2009 stats, Palsoni village is also a gram panchayat.

About Palsoni
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Palsoni is 543960. The village spans a total geographical area of 866.87 hectares. Wani is nearest town to Palsoni village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 5km away.

Population of Palsoni
Below is a concise population overview of Palsoni as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,720 | 905 | 815 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 166 | 89 | 77 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 304 | 163 | 141 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 237 | 123 | 114 |
Literate Population | 1,299 | 733 | 566 |
Illiterate Population | 421 | 172 | 249 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Palsoni village:
- The total population of Palsoni village is around 1,720, including approximately 905 males and 815 females, with a sex ratio of 900 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 166 children aged 0–6 years in Palsoni village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Palsoni village has 304 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 237 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Palsoni village is about 75.52%, with male literacy at 80.99% and female literacy at 69.45%.
- There are around 408 households in Palsoni village.
Connectivity of Palsoni
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Palsoni. As per the 2011 stats, Palsoni had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
